We are delighted to the announce that following their first Ofsted Inspection from 16-18 November 2021, Ofsted have judged The Cornerstone Academy to be ‘Good’ in all areas. Ofsted said that “Cornerstone Academy is a happy, caring school. Pupils who previously have been disengaged from education thrive and achieve well”.
Established by Damien Sweeney, Headteacher in January 2019, The Cornerstone Academy has only been formally open for just over a year making this achievement even more commendable during the current challenges and obstacles the pandemic has presented.
The Academy, part of The YES Trust (Youth Engagement Schools Trust) operates across two sites in East Cheshire, with a small provision at Marlfields Primary Academy in Congleton and a larger provision at The Stables in Crewe. The Cornerstone Academy is an innovative and different type of school that provides opportunities for children in Reception to Year 6, who are currently unable to meet the demands of mainstream education, to re-engage and foster a love of learning. The overriding ethos of the Academy, is to unlock the potential of vulnerable, disengaged children to realise their tremendous potential and equip them with the resilience and knowledge to achieve and develop positive futures both academically and socially.
